## Build Provenance: GlacierDiff

GlacierDiff, the Ferrow workbench's large-file diff viewer, is built exclusively through the attested Marlowe pipeline. Plugin authors should verify that any GlacierDiff binary they extend carries a signed manifest, since chunked-rendering hooks differ between builds. Unverified builds may expose incompatible plugin APIs and should never be targeted. Before publishing a plugin, confirm your target against the official manifest. The current release's provenance token follows below.

session token of kageg-tahop = htk14_af3c1ccccb7dcf

Contrastor runs automated color-contrast audits against the Mallowbrook design system and files findings through our internal tracker. All thresholds live in audit.yml: WCAG level, minimum ratio, and the page allowlist. For your security review, note that Contrastor only reads rendered DOM snapshots and never stores screenshots beyond the 24-hour retention window set by SNAPSHOT_TTL_HOURS. Results are pushed to the tracker over an authenticated channel, and that push requires the credential declared on the next line of the environment file.

secret setting of fahip-yawif: COURIER_KEY29=a2f9f2701e841dc651d87d9072a5b

Subject: Portionary cut-over complete

Cut-over of the Portionary recipe-scaling calculator to the new Grammet cluster finished at 02:10 local. Traffic shifted in three steps, no rollbacks. Unit-conversion tables re-seeded from the Fennwick dataset; spot checks on scaling factors passed. Old instances drain for 48 hours, then we decommission. One known issue: fractional-yield rounding logs a benign warning, fix queued. Monitoring dashboards updated. For the record, the service now starts with the configuration values listed below.

deployment values, kajep-kageg:
[praix]
host = praix.paliqcorp.corp
user = praix_svc
database = praix_prod

## Further reading

The Larkbell reminder job scans the Petrel scheduling store every 15 minutes and enqueues SMS and email reminders for appointments within the next 48 hours. Deduplication relies on a composite key of patient record and slot, so review changes to key construction carefully. Quiet-hours suppression and retry semantics are covered in the design note. The full architecture write-up, including the idempotency discussion, lives on the internal wiki page.

runbook for badug-kadup: https://confluence.zemvarlabs.internal/projects/browse/display/projects/bd1b